Rajgira Sheera
15 minute rajgira sheera is a vrat and upvas friendly and gluten-free Indian dessert made with amaranth flour, cardamom, and sugar. This is a healthier version that uses less ghee than most recipes.

- 2 tbsp ghee Can add 1-2 more tbsp if you would like
- ¾ cup amaranth flour rajgira flour, 115g
- ½ cup milk
- ⅓ cup sugar 70g
- 1 tsp cardamom powder
- ¼ cup nuts 40g
Melt ghee in a pot on medium heat.
Next, add amaranth flour to ghee and roast the flour. It will take 3-4 minutes. You will notice a fragrant, nutty smell and the color deepen in color a bit.
Add milk. Mix and let cook another 5-6 minutes.
Sheera will thicken and begin to pull away from sides of the pan.
Then, add sugar and mix well.
Last, add crushed nuts and cardamom powder. Let it thicken a little and serve warm.
